fix: turn warnings into errors

for the few warnings we get, at least make sure we listen to them now on unix platforms.  Windows has too many right now to enable /WX

# Workaround for compiler bug where the optimized code could result in a memcpy of 0 bytes, even though that isnt possible.
# https://gcc.gnu.org/bugzilla/show_bug.cgi?id=97185
if (CMAKE_CXX_COMPILER_ID STREQUAL "GNU")
set_source_files_properties("FdbToSqlite.cpp" PROPERTIES COMPILE_FLAGS "-Wno-stringop-overflow")
endif()
